Outline of Final Research Achievements |
In South Korea ,Urban Industrial Mission –Christian group for evangelizing labor started their work at 1958. In 1970’s, they became activists and tried to help labor movements because they were keeping relationship with labor or labor unions. At Yeongdeungpo , Seoul, UIM began their mission by forming a connection with employer. Then they tried to approach Labor unions, the Economic Planning Board and Korea Productivity Center for solution of industrial problems. However at the end of 1960’s their evangelizing and charity for labor failed. Therefore they had to reconstruct relationship with labor, they were trying to turn their mission into a social movement. Christians of UIM changed their policy by communication with labor.
